I got this guitar b/c it seemed to have decent reviews, and looked really cool, and was wanting another non-expensive off brand axe to kick around on. In the low end catagory, I have purchased SX SST strat copy and a KY22. The strat needed better tuners, but otherwise was great. KY had a headstock so big it barely had the tuner posts sticking out.

Anyway, I knew there would need to be some mods, more than likely. If it totally sucked, I figured it would look cool on my wall.
The good:
Look: Very cool, like it has been yellowing away in gradma's attic. Which was on fire at some point.
The good and bad:
Hardware: Tuners tight, bridge/trem OK. Pickups, listed as 'EMG Designed', I doubt are. The two single coils were ok and stratty, with real pole pieces but the so-called bridge humbucker, had a plastic top with fake pole pieces stamped on it, and didn't sound like a humbucker. The guitar was noisy as hell-bad wiring or loose ground or something. Input jack and 5 way selector ok. Nut needed some graphite, and the strings were brand new .9's. The few guitars I've gotten on the net have always had old rusted strings. So, I was able to play it right outa the box, get some strat twang, no humbucker warmth though. Frets solid, but the neck was off a bit and the low E was very close to the edge of the fingerboard. That may be fixable, but not a big deal cuz who uses the high notes on bass strings that often anyway?

So,,,,I have a friend who sets up guitars professionally, and will see what the deal is with the noise and the lousy humbucker sound. If the pickups are the only thing needing replacing, then yeah, this is an awesome buy for a 200 axe to put a little work into it and a sliver of money and get a rockin guitar for under 400.

Shipping: Huge box. On time. No problems.

UPDATE 5/07/09
After a set up and some rewiring, this guitar screams! I can trem dive and it will return to pich! Snug tuners. I guess these are EMG designed, cuz now the humbucker sounds par excellence!
Customer Service-Very good. Nice, sincere people concerned about QC. My trem arm broke off at the threading. I happened upon an AXL booth at the Dallas Guitar Show in March, and mentioned my dillema. The gentleman got my info and I emailed him at the site a week later. Turns out the best way to get emails to them is through the Johnson site. The AXL link isn't connecting or whatever.
So yeah,,,I'd be changing this to 5 Stars but the damn thing won't let me.

Product Description:
With a distressed body and antiqued hardware, Badwater Series guitars look and feel of ancient artifacts. These shocking guitars are equipped with EMG-designed pickups for hard rocking tones and clean delivery. Even the headstock and backplate have vintage distressing. No area was spared from the destruction. Badwater guitars have a one-of-a-kind style and excellent playability.The crackle blue finish looks like it was pulled deep from the ocean floor.The Badwater Series has received Guitar World's December 2007 Gold Award for Overall Value.
